
Hornby TT:120 MHA Coalfish ballast wagon EWS 396082
The MHA 'Coalfish' wagons were rebuilds of HAA hoppers using the original chassis with the addition of a new body to suit transport of engineers spoil.
The rebuilds were carried out between 1997-2007 under TOPS code MHA with examples built at RFS Conaster, Wabtec Doncaster, EWS Margam and Marcroft Engineering in Stoke-on-Trent.
This MHA is one of the later Doncaster-built EWS 'Coalfish' ballast wagon conversions completed between 2003-2004. It is finished in EWS maroon with a yellow top edge and carried number 396082.
